![]() ![]() ![]() Now when you cast to your TV, you don't have to change the input. If you have it, then use the TV remote and go to Settings and select the HDMI-CEC option and enable it. Samsung - Anynet+ Sony - BRAVIA Link or BRAVIA Sync Sharp - Aquos Link Hitachi - HDMI-CEC AOC - E-link Pioneer - Kuro Link Toshiba - Regza Link or CE-Link Onkyo - RIHD (Remote Interactive over HDMI) LG - SimpLink Panasonic - VIERA Link or HDAVI Control or EZ-Sync Philips - EasyLink Mitsubishi - NetCommand for HDMI Runco International – RuncoLink Google the model of your TV and the trade name for HDMI-CEC that matches the brand: ![]() ![]() You've probably used your phone as a remote for your cable or Chromecast, but you might not know that you can use it to bypass the process of having to change the input to cast if your TV supports HDMI-CEC.
